Wood paint removal services involve carefully stripping away old, peeling, or worn paint from wooden surfaces such as decks, fences, siding, and interior woodwork. This process typically uses specialized tools and techniques to safely eliminate layers of paint without damaging the underlying wood. Whether the goal is to refresh the appearance of a property or prepare surfaces for a new coat of paint, professional wood paint removal ensures a clean, smooth surface that promotes better adhesion for subsequent coatings.
This service helps address common problems associated with aging or deteriorating paint, including cracking, peeling, and bubbling. Over time, paint on wood surfaces can become compromised due to exposure to weather, moisture, and sunlight, leading to unsightly appearances and potential wood damage. Removing old paint can also reveal underlying issues such as rot, mold, or insect damage, enabling property owners to address these problems before applying new finishes.

The overview below groups typical Wood Paint Removal proj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Victoria, TX.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Small-scale projects - typical costs range from $250 to $600 for routine wood paint removal on single doors or small surfaces. Many local contractors handle these jobs efficiently within this range, which covers most standard repairs.
Medium-sized jobs - costs usually fall between $600 and $1,500 for larger areas like decks or multiple surfaces. These projects are common and tend to stay within this middle range, depending on surface size and condition.
Large or complex projects - prices can reach $1,500 to $3,000 or more for extensive work such as multi-story facades or detailed restoration. Fewer projects push into this higher tier, which reflects more involved preparation and labor.
Full replacement or major renovations - larger, more comprehensive projects can exceed $5,000, especially when extensive surface preparation or multiple structures are involved. These are less common but represent the upper end of typical costs for comprehensive wood paint removal services.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What methods do local contractors use for wood paint removal? Local service providers may use techniques such as chemical stripping, sanding, or heat-based removal to effectively strip paint from wood surfaces.
Is professional paint removal safe for delicate wood furniture? Yes, experienced contractors select appropriate methods to ensure safe removal without damaging the underlying wood.
Can paint removal services handle exterior wood surfaces? Yes, local contractors are equipped to remove paint from various exterior wood surfaces like decks, siding, and fences.
What preparation is needed before wood paint removal? Typically, surfaces should be cleared of furniture and debris; specific prep steps can be discussed with local service providers.
Do paint removal methods vary based on the type of paint or wood? Yes, the choice of technique often depends on the type of paint used and the condition of the wood surface.
